blubbery

/ˈblʌbri/

Definitions

1. adjective

having a lot of fatty tissue; soft and rounded

“The blubbery belly of the walrus made it difficult to swim.”

2. noun

a blubbery substance or thing

“The blubbery texture of the mousse made it unappetizing.”
